Marvel’s greatest heroes are respected by their fellow heroes, inspiring every life they touch. There are some great heroes though, ones who have saved the Earth many times over, who still aren’t trustworthy. When it comes to saving the day, they can be depended upon. However, that’s as far as trusting them goes.

These Marvel heroes have done plenty of shady things, lying to their fellow heroes and deceiving innocent people so they could have their way. Some of them might not lie, but they can’t be trusted to work well with others or look out for themselves first and foremost. They’re great heroes, but they aren’t perfect heroes.

10/10 Black Panther Puts Wakanda First And Foremost

Black Panther stands in front of the Wakandan skyline, flags burning, in Marvel Comics

Many Marvel heroes have political careers and Black Panther is perhaps the most prominent. He’s a well-known leader on the world stage. In recent years, he’s led the Avengers, but his past tenures with the team showed that he wasn’t exactly trustworthy. If it comes to choosing between Wakanda and anything else, T’Challa will always choose Wakanda.

The Black Panther will lie and cheat if it means Wakanda will prosper. He puts his people first, which is what should be expected of a monarch. The fact that his most recent tenure as an Avenger was so successful is a change of pace for him since he’s left the team multiple times so he could better rule Wakanda.

9/10 Scarlet Witch Breaks Too Easily

Hellfire Gala Scarlet Witch with headdress in Marvel Comics

Scarlet Witch is the most powerful member of the Avengers. She’s been instrumental in many of the team’s victories, but trusting her can be rather hard. Scarlet Witch is known for breaking and betraying the team. She’s gone through some very traumatic experiences and, as a result, has attacked the team multiple times.

Scarlet Witch can be trusted most of the time, but everyone keeps an eye on her. It’s hard to know how some things are going to affect her, and when Scarlet Witch breaks, she breaks very badly. She’s a big gun, but sometimes that gun gets turned on her closest friends.

8/10 Havok’s Mind Has Been Messed With Too Many Times

Marvel Comics' Havok wearing his Hellfire Gala outfit in 2022

Havok has had a rough time. He lost his parents at a young age, was separated from his brother, and then had to live in Cyclops’s shadow when he joined the X-Men. He’s been mind-controlled multiple times, leaving him easily manipulated, and he had his morality inverted in AXIS. Havok can be a great hero and leader, but he’s also rather fragile when it comes right down to it.

It’s hard to know which version of Havok is going to show up on any given day. The ease that he can be manipulated with has affected him very badly, to the point that he was part of the Hellions, a team for mutants who weren’t stable. Havok’s problems have dragged down everyone around him many times.

7/10 The Hulk Is Rage Personified

The Hulk sits on a throne in Marvel Comics

The Hulk has defeated Marvel’s strongest characters. He’s been an Avenger and a Defender, helping to battle the worst threats to the Earth. He’s also been known to attack the people he’s worked with in the past. It’s hard to always call it betrayal, but the Hulk is definitely an untrustworthy hero.

The problem with the Hulk is that he is controlled by his anger. He’ll turn on a dime in the middle of a fight depending on which Hulk is in control. Some Hulks are known for being liars, making crafty plans that often revolve around trickery and lies. The Hulk’s power is sometimes necessary, but no hero relishes working with him.

6/10 Daredevil’s Lawyer Background Makes Him Okay With Lies

Marvel Comics' Daredevil standing in front of a church

Daredevil is Marvel’s best lawyer. For years, Matt Murdock was a defense lawyer. While Murdock does his best to only represent people who are innocent, defense lawyers have to manipulate facts. Daredevil has taken this to heart. Lies aren’t always bad, so Daredevil has no problem lying when he needs to.

The best example of this was when Daredevil’s identity was revealed. He lied to everyone around him, including his friends, even when his secret identity was obviously blown. Daredevil is still a great hero, and he’s saved many lives over the years. However, there’s always the chance that he’ll lie if it’s convenient.

5/10 The Beast Has Become Very Amoral

Beast menacingly looks over sharp thorns on Krakoa in Marvel Comics

Many Marvel heroes aren’t honorable, and there are a variety of reasons behind this. For the Beast, it was the tribulations of the mutant race post-M-Day. He watched his people reduced to a pitiful remnant and saw them victimized over and over again. After Cyclops became Dark Phoenix, Beast decided to take a chance with the space-time continuum and bring the original five X-Men from the past into his timeline.

Beast joined the Illuminati and helped them commit genocide on a massive scale during the Incursions. He’s led X-Force on Krakoa and has embraced black ops like he was born to it. He keeps secrets, commits atrocities, and constantly justifies his behaviors with more lies and obfuscations. At this point, no one should trust Hank.

4/10 Professor X Has Used His Powers To Keep Secrets And Lie For Years

Marvel Comics' Xavier connects to the X-Men's minds in Powers of X

Many Marvel heroes keep secrets, but few are as good at it as Professor X. It’s part of the nature of his powers. Xavier’s telepathy makes it a snap for him to make people forget he lied to them or what he lied about. He has no problem using his powers to protect his people and as a leader he’s lied to his students many times.

Professor X is a former member of the Illuminati and he founded the mutant nation of Krakoa on a lie, keeping the truth about it and Moira MacTaggert from nearly everyone. The X-Men have suffered because of his lies many times and they’ve written him off before. However, they always give him another chance and he always lies again.

3/10 Namor Switches Sides All The Time

An image of Namor swimming through the ocean in Marvel Comics

Namor the Sub-Mariner is the king of Atlantis. He’s a former member of the Defenders, Avengers, X-Men, Illuminati, and the Cabal. He’s helped save the world many times. He’s also attacked the surface world regularly. Namor switches sides like some heroes change their costumes.

Sometimes Namor’s a hero and sometimes he’s a villain. His closest ally in the world isn’t a superhero, but Doctor Doom. He’s known for having crushes on other heroes’ wives and girlfriends, especially blondes like Invisible Woman or Emma Frost. Namor is great to have as an ally, but the chances of him switching sides is basically fifty-fifty.

2/10 Odin Is Known For Being A Secretive Monarch

Odin stands between Loki and Thor in Marvel Comics

Thor is the hero of Asgard’s 10 Realms and Midgard. He’s known for being a very direct hero, something he definitely didn’t learn from his father Odin. As the ruler of Asgard, Odin is used to making decisions completely on his own. He’s made sacrifices for knowledge several times over his life and has knowledge he rarely shares with anyone.

Odin has kept knowledge from his sons many times over the years. Being a leader is a hard thing; Odin understands a big picture that his subjects can’t know. Trusting Odin can be a mistake, as he always plays his cards very close to the vest. In his mythological history, he’s almost always betrayed others when it suited him, making him the architect of many of his greatest problems.

1/10 Iron Man Has Lied To His Friends Many Times

Marvel Comics' Invincible Iron Man charges his repulsor beams

Iron Man hasn’t always been the best hero. Sure, he’s a founding Avenger and has personally saved the Earth multiple times, but he’s often done it by being as pragmatic as possible. Iron Man is known for lying to his fellow heroes. He’s betrayed them in some big ways, working with the government during the Civil Wars and even going after his friends during the Armor Wars.

Iron Man helped found the Illuminati, a secret society that did as much harm as good. During the Incursions, he was culpable in genocide. Iron Man has no problem lying if it saves the day. His friends know that he’s going to give it his all, but they stopped expecting honesty from him long ago.
